Overview
LTC1743CFW#PBF from Analog Devices (formerly Linear Technology) is a 12-bit, 50Msps pipelined analog-to-digital converter optimized for high-frequency, wide-dynamic-range signal digitization in communications systems. It features ±1V or ±1.6V differential input ranges, 72.5dB SNR at 3.2V range, 85dB SFDR, and ultralow 0.3psRMS aperture jitter - enabling undersampling of IF signals in cellular base stations and spectrum analyzers.
For engineers reviewing the LTC1743CFW#PBF datasheet, LTC1743CFW#PBF pinout, LTC1743CFW#PBF application, or LTC1743CFW#PBF equivalent, key selection criteria include its 48-pin TSSOP package with flow-through layout, resistor-programmable input range, differential ENC/ENC interface compatibility with PECL/GTL/TTL/CMOS, and separate OVDD supply (0.5V–5V) for direct interfacing with low-voltage DSPs or FIFOs.
Technical Context
The LTC1743CFW#PBF implements a four-stage CMOS pipelined ADC architecture with internal residue amplification and digital correction logic, delivering 12-bit resolution with no missing codes across temperature. Its sample-and-hold uses direct capacitor sampling (7pF CSAMPLE) and achieves 150MHz full-power bandwidth with 7.5ns acquisition time.
It supports dual reference configurations via the SENSE pin (ground = ±1V, VDD = ±1.6V), integrates a 2.5V VCM output with ±30ppm/°C tempco, and provides offset binary or 2's complement output format selectable via MSBINV. The ENC/ENC differential encode interface accepts sinusoidal drive without performance degradation.

Pinout & Package
The LTC1743CFW#PBF is housed in a 48-lead plastic TSSOP (FW package) with flow-through pinout optimized for high-speed PCB layout and minimal trace coupling.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| AIN+, AIN– | Differential analog input pair | Accepts ±1V or ±1.6V differential signal; requires matched 100Ω source impedance for optimal SFDR. |
| SENSE | Input range selection | Ground = ±1V range; VDD = ±1.6V range; intermediate voltage sets proportional range. |
| VCM | Common-mode bias output | 2.5V reference (±30ppm/°C) for driving transformer center-taps or op-amp VOCM pins. |
| ENC, ENC | Differential encode clock inputs | Edge-triggered conversion start; accepts PECL, GTL, TTL, CMOS, or sine-wave drive without degradation. |
| OE | Output enable | Active-low control for bus sharing; places D0–D11 and OF in high-impedance state when high. |
| OVDD | Digital output supply | Independent 0.5V–5V rail - allows direct connection to 1.8V/2.5V/3.3V/5V logic without level shifters. |
| D0–D11 | Parallel digital outputs | 12-bit offset binary or 2's complement data; D0 = LSB, D11 = MSB; latched on CLKOUT rising edge. |
| CLKOUT | Data valid strobe | Internally generated clock synchronized to data - eliminates external timing alignment complexity. |

FAQ
What input voltage ranges does the LTC1743CFW#PBF support, and how are they selected?
The LTC1743CFW#PBF supports two differential input ranges: ±1V and ±1.6V. Selection is made via the SENSE pin - grounding SENSE selects ±1V, connecting SENSE to VDD selects ±1.6V. Intermediate voltages between 1V and 1.6V scale the range proportionally (e.g., 1.3V yields ±1.3V). This resistor-programmable feature allows optimization for varying front-end gain without redesigning the signal chain. The LTC1743CFW#PBF datasheet specifies full AC performance across both ranges.
Does the LTC1743CFW#PBF require external reference components, and what is the role of the VCM pin?
No, the LTC1743CFW#PBF integrates an internal 2.5V bandgap reference and differential reference buffer - only external bypass capacitors (4.7µF on REFHA/REFLA, 0.1µF on REFLB/REFHB) are required. The VCM pin provides a buffered 2.5V common-mode output with ±30ppm/°C tempco, intended to bias transformer center-taps or op-amp VOCM inputs. It must be bypassed to AGND with ≥4.7µF ceramic capacitance per the LTC1743CFW#PBF layout guidelines.
How does the ENC/ENC differential interface operate, and can it accept single-ended signals?
The ENC and ENC pins form a true differential encode input that triggers conversion on the ENC-to-ENC transition. For single-ended use, ENC is driven with the clock signal while ENC is bypassed to ground via 0.1µF. The LTC1743CFW#PBF's low-noise, high-gain ENC/ENC receivers also accept sinusoidal drive directly - eliminating need for clock conditioning circuitry. Timing parameters (t1, t2) are specified for both differential and single-ended modes in the LTC1743CFW#PBF datasheet.
What is the purpose of the OVDD supply, and what voltage range is supported?
The OVDD supply powers only the digital output drivers (D0–D11, CLKOUT, OF), decoupling them from the analog VDD domain. It supports 0.5V to 5V, enabling direct interfacing with 1.8V, 2.5V, 3.3V, or 5V logic families without level shifters. This separation minimizes digital switching noise coupling into analog sections. The LTC1743CFW#PBF specifies VOH/VOL and timing (t4, t5, t6) across the full OVDD range, ensuring robust operation in mixed-voltage systems.
Is the LTC1743CFW#PBF pin-compatible with other members of the LTC174x family, and which variants share the same footprint?
Yes, the LTC1743CFW#PBF is pin-compatible with the entire LTC174x family in the 48-pin TSSOP (FW) package, including LTC1741, LTC1742, LTC1744, LTC1745, LTC1746, LTC1747, and LTC1748. All share identical pinout, power sequencing, and interface signaling - allowing drop-in upgrades (e.g., LTC1743CFW#PBF → LTC1744CFW#PBF for 14-bit resolution) or downgrades without PCB revision. This compatibility is explicitly confirmed in the LTC1743CFW#PBF datasheet's "Pin Compatible Family" section.
